site stats

How to reverse a linked list in c language

Web30 apr. 2024 · In my previous post, I have explained C program to reverse a singly linked list. In this post, We are going to write a code to reverse a linked list using recursion. If …

How do I reverse a linked list in C language? - CodeProject

Web17 jul. 2024 · To reverse the given linked list we will use three extra pointers that will be in the process. The pointers will be previous, after, current. We will initialize previous and … Web4 jun. 2024 · To know how to reverse the linked list using recursion in c programming without losing the information, the recursion can serve as the most efficient way. First, to … chvk bear on back https://connersmachinery.com

Reverse a singly-linked list Codewars

WebRecursive Procedure for Reversing a Linked List Pseudo Code: void Reverse (Node *q, Node *p) { if (p != NULL) { Reverse (p, p->next); p->next = q; } else first = q; } Program … Web8 aug. 2024 · There are two ways to reverse a linked list. We can reverse a linked list using an iterative approach or we can reverse a linked list using recursion. Both … Web2 aug. 2009 · Given pointer to the head node of a linked list, the task is to reverse the linked list. We need to reverse the list by changing links between nodes. Examples: Input : Head of following linked list 1->2->3->4->NULL Output : Linked list should be changed to, 4->3 … dfw clubs

Print reverse of a Linked List without actually reversing

Category:Print reverse of a Linked List without actually reversing

Tags:How to reverse a linked list in c language

How to reverse a linked list in c language

C program to reverse a doubly linked list - Codeforwin

WebReversing a linked list in C++: Reversing a linked list in C++ or any other programming languages works in a same way. We needs to follow few steps for that. In this post, I will … WebReverse Linked List - Given the head of a singly linked list, reverse the list, and return the reversed list ... [0, 5000]. * -5000 <= Node.val <= 5000 Follow up: A linked list can …

How to reverse a linked list in c language

Did you know?

WebHow to reverse a Linked List by changing the links between the nodes. Step 1 – We will take three pointers ptr1, ptr2 and ptr3. Initially the first and the third pointer will point … WebReverse a Linked List in C using Iterative Approach. Reverse a Linked List in C using Stack. Reverse a Linked List in C using Three Pointer. Reverse a Linked List in C …

Web17 dec. 2024 · The space complexity of this solution is O(N) since we create a recursive stack for each recursive function call. O(N) is the time complexity of this solution, since … Web26 sep. 2015 · Steps to reverse a Singly Linked List Create two more pointers other than head namely prevNode and curNode that will hold the reference of previous node …

Web15 mei 2024 · This method will initialize the three-pointer variable, e.g., curr as head of the linked list, next and pre as NULL. Then, we will traverse the linked list in a loop and do … Web6 feb. 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ebBack to: Data Structures and Algorithms Tutorials Finding Maximum Element in a Linked List using C Language: In this article, I am going to discuss How to Find the Maximum Element in a Linked List using C Language with Examples.Please read our previous article, where we discussed the Sum of all elements in a Linked List using C Language …

Web23 jul. 2013 · If you don't want to change the struct of node, you should divide the sentence into words according blank. You can reverse each word first and then reverse the entire … dfw coaches clinic 2023Web23 jan. 2024 · Get this post in pdf - Reverse Linked List. Reference: Introduction to Algorithms The Algorithm Design Manual Data Structures and Algorithms Made Easy. … dfw club volleyball teamsWeb11 okt. 2024 · Finally, after changing the links, we will have to make 27 as the new head of the linked list. So, the final reverse linked list will be: Now, I think from the above … dfw club loungeWebReverse linked list formed from the above linked list − 85 -> 10 -> 65 -> 32 -> 9 -> NULL To reverse the given linked list we will use three extra pointers that will be in the … dfw coaches clinic 2022Web29 nov. 2024 · Reverse a Linked List using C - In this article, we need to reverse the links with the help of a singly linked list. Our task is to create a function that is capable of … dfw cluster repairWeb17 mrt. 2024 · C Program to Reverse a Linked List Reversing a linked list means re-arranging the next (connection) pointers. Head will point to the last node and the first … dfw coaches clinic 2016Web9 mei 2024 · struct node *reverse () { if (tail == NULL) { printf ("List is empty"); return tail; } struct node *nxt,*prv,*p = tail->next; do { nxt = p->next; prv = p->prev; p->next = prv; p … dfw cobras football